Qiong Xiang is a scholar working on Physiology, Cellular and Molecular Neuroscience and Molecular Biology. According to data from OpenAlex, Qiong Xiang has authored 25 papers receiving a total of 317 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Physiology, 7 papers in Cellular and Molecular Neuroscience and 5 papers in Molecular Biology. Recurrent topics in Qiong Xiang’s work include Pain Mechanisms and Treatments (6 papers), Neuropeptides and Animal Physiology (5 papers) and Fuel Cells and Related Materials (4 papers). Qiong Xiang is often cited by papers focused on Pain Mechanisms and Treatments (6 papers), Neuropeptides and Animal Physiology (5 papers) and Fuel Cells and Related Materials (4 papers). Qiong Xiang collaborates with scholars based in China, Sweden and Australia. Qiong Xiang's co-authors include Tomas Hökfelt, Tiejun Shi, Xianhui Li, Kaj Fried, Mingdong Zhang, Wei Jia, Yan Wang, Chunyan Li, Anna Josephson and Xiao‐Jun Xu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Comparative Neurology and Macromolecules.
